ESP32微型遥控小车远程控制与监控系统建设
发布时间: 2024-03-31 02:06:52 阅读量: 84 订阅数: 47 ![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![ZIP](https://csdnimg.cn/release/download/static_files/pc/images/minetype/ZIP.png)
基于ESP32的智能遥控小车
# 1. 介绍ESP32微型遥控小车系统的概念及应用
ESP32微型遥控小车系统是一种基于ESP32开发板搭建的远程控制与监控系统,能够通过移动App实现对小车的遥控以及实时监控功能。在现代生活中,ESP32微型遥控小车已经被广泛应用于智能家居、物流配送、教育科研等领域。通过这样的系统,用户可以方便地远程控制小车进行移动、拍摄视频等操作,极大地提升了操作便利性和用户体验。
# 2. ESP32微型遥控小车的硬件搭建与连接
ESP32微型遥控小车的硬件构建是整个系统的基础,只有正确连接和搭建硬件,才能实现远程控制和监控的功能。在这一章节中,我们将详细介绍ESP32微型遥控小车的硬件配置和连接方式,以帮助您顺利搭建您自己的遥控小车系统。
### 2.1 ESP32微型开发板和相关传感器硬件介绍
ESP32是一款功能强大的微控制器,具有WiFi和蓝牙功能,适用于物联网应用和嵌入式系统。在搭建遥控小车系统时,我们通常会选择一块ESP32开发板作为控制核心,并配备各种传感器如超声波传感器、红外传感器等,以实现小车的避障和导航功能。
### 2.2 搭建ESP32微型遥控小车的硬件连接图解
在连接ESP32微型遥控小车的硬件时,需要准确连接各个元件,包括电机驱动模块、传感器、电池等。下面是一个简单的硬件连接图解,帮助您了解各个元件之间的连接方式。
```
// 代码示例:硬件连接图解
// 定义引脚连接
const int motorPin1 = 13;
const int motorPin2 = 14;
const int ultrasonicEchoPin = 4;
const int ultrasonicTrigPin = 5;
// 设置引脚模式
pinMode(motorPin1, OUTPUT);
pinMode(motorPin2, OUTPUT);
pinMode(ultrasonicEchoPin, INPUT);
pinMode(ultrasonicTrigPin, OUTPUT);
// 其他传感器等连接方式类似,根据具体硬件接口进行连接
```
### 2.3 如何选择合适的电池供电ESP32微型遥控小车
在搭建ESP32微型遥控小车时,电池的选择是至关重要的。需要根据小车的功率需求和运行时间来选择合适的电池容量和电压等参数。常用的电池包括锂电池、干电池等,可以根据实际情况选择适合的电池类型和容量。
通过以上硬件搭建与连接的介绍,您可以更清晰地了解如何构建ESP32微型遥控小车的硬件系统,为后续的控制和监控系统搭建打下坚实的基础。
# 3. 移动App远程控制系统搭建
在本章中,我们将详细介绍如何搭建移动App远程控制系统,实现对ESP32微型遥控小车的远程操作。
#### 3.1 选择合适的移动App控制ESP32微型遥控小车
在搭建移动App远程控制系统之前,
0
0
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20241231044930.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)